You asked: How to import text in coreldraw ?

Position the import cursor in the drawing page, and click. Click and drag on the drawing page to define the size of the text frame. Press the Spacebar to place the imported text in the default location. For more information about importing a specific file format, see Supported file formats.

What is import command in CorelDRAW?

You can import files created in other applications. For example, you can import an Adobe Portable Document Format (PDF), JPEG, or Adobe Illustrator (AI) file. You can import a file and place it in the active application window as an object. You can also resize and center a file as you import it.

How do I add text in Corel Paint?

Click in the image window, and type the text. You can render the text as an editable area by selecting the text with the Text tool and clicking the Create mask button on the property bar. This produces a text-shaped editable area to which you can apply effects. Click the Text tool .

What is text tool in CorelDRAW?

CorelDRAW’s Text tool can create two types of text: artistic text is great for when you only need to add a word, or a line or two, and paragraph text can be used when you have more to say.

How do I import files into CorelDRAW?

  1. Press File > Import.
  2. Select any folder in which the image has been stored.
  3. Select the file format through a list box near to the box of the File name.
  4. Press on the file name.
  5. Press on the arrow near to the button, i.e., Import, and then press Resample and load.

Can you import a PDF into CorelDRAW?

You can open AI and PDF files by using the File > Open command as you would any CorelDRAW file, or you can import them. When you open AI and PDF files, they are opened as CorelDRAW files. When you import AI and PDF files, they are imported as grouped objects and can be placed anywhere within your current drawing.

How can you import and export files from CorelDRAW explain?

Open CorelDRAW file and activate the page containing objects that you need to export. Select Export from File menu. (File >Export) This will bring up the export dialog box. Select the desired type of file format you wish to export as.
